Omnath just feels like he was designed for EDH play. With the 21-damage clause especially, you can clear players pretty quickly.
Basically just go for a turn 3 Omnath. If someone uses a removal spell on him that early, it's no big deal - 5 mana still is pretty easy to get. Try and make sure you can throw hexproof on him relatively early to prevent annoying removal thingies, and then trample when possible. Seeing as you don't have many other creatures, fog-esque spells are handy to prevent yourself from being crushed while Omnath is tapped.

Seedborn Muse would be a good fit.Naturalize doesn't handle Theros gods or indestructible creatures, it just lets them recast Sharuum or Memnarch, it lets Wurmcoil Engine kick tokens and lets people with graveyard recursion recurr the card. I'd much rather exile it with Fade Into Antiquity or tuck with Deglamer in 99.9% of situations.
deglamer is good, i would put in nantulo vigilante and seal of primordium first though. but i depends on play group.seal for the psychological impact and once played can only be stopped with stifle and nantulo vigilante because its a morph ability which means it doesnt se the staack and its instant speed.
Both still have a lot of the same problems as Naturalize though; they won't hit a Theros god, anything Darksteel, anything when a person has Avacyn out, it allows a artifact general to just be recast, etc. A Sharuum player is basically going to dare you to use it so he can just recast his general. That said, maybe those things don't matter where you play. The table I play at you want to exile or tuck artifacts or enchantments whenever possible because there's so many of the above-mentioned problems to deal with, but that may not apply elsewhere.
